Imposing at the front, powerful at the rear, the BMW 7 Series Sedan is a vehicle that exudes confidence. The large kidney grilles emphasize the new BMW 7 Series' imposing presence while the striking shoulder line extends uninterrupted from bonnet to boot, making the car seem longer. The door handles are integrated seamlessly into this shoulder line, creating an inimitable effect even at night.

Generous space, precise elegance and charming functionality form the character of the BMW 7 Series Sedan. The interior's finish, including a wide range of high-class materials and a handcrafted look, conveys a new interpretation of inviting modernity. A particularly eye-catching feature of the cockpit is the instrument cluster with black panel technology - when not in use, the display is matt black, and it comes to life in several stages when the ignition is started. High-tech, special ceramic material is also offered as an option on selected control elements and switches.

No matter what speed you're travelling at or road surface you're driving on, you're guaranteed outstanding driving comfort in the BMW 7 Series Sedan. The new shock absorbers send information four hundred times a second to the Dynamic Damping Control system and are now infinitely and independently adjustable for both compression and rebound damping. This means that the dampers adapt to the state of the road irrespective of which Dynamic Driving Control mode is selected, for exceptional ride comfort even when driving hard on bumpy surfaces.

Only the tachometer will reveal how fast and seamlessly the new 8-speed automatic transmission Steptronic shifts gears. The additional gears reduce the engine's rev interval between shifts, so the transmission process is barely noticeable. The eighth gear reduces the number of revolutions at high speeds, tangibly increasing comfort while reducing fuel consumption and emissions.

The perfectly-spaced gear ratios of the responsive six-speed automatic transmission Steptronic ensure that the vast power of the BMW 7 Series engine is transmitted to the drive wheels with maximum efficiency. A newly developed control shifts gears faster, and when the driver kicks down the accelerator, the automatic transmission will shift back immediately by up to four gears. Minimum converter slip and exact selection of gears increases spontaneity and efficiency and the gears can be shifted manually thanks to the electronic gear selector lever

To ensure that the superior driving dynamics of the BMW 740d and 750i remain constant on every surface, the intelligent all-wheel drive system xDrive distributes engine power variably to both axles as the situation requires. The system allows the driver to enjoy the full power and agility of the vehicle by providing noticeably more traction on every surface. Whether you are on a winding road, attempting a hill start or tackling slippery surfaces, optimal traction is guaranteed.

The optional Integral Active Steering system which varies the steering angle of the rear wheels increases safety, stability and comfort to particularly benefit rear-seat passengers. At higher speeds Integral Active Steering ensures extremely comfortable and superior response on the road when changing lanes and in bends. At low speeds the car's turning circle is decreased to significantly enhance agility and nimble performance. In addition to the enhancement of stability in quick direction changes, Active Steering also ensures even greater superiority and better handling in brake manoeuvres.

Stable and smooth. Light and strong. These are the requirements of a BMW 7 Series chassis. Requirements the double-arm front axle meets with ease. The dampers are able to respond with supreme smoothness while the light aluminium structure reduces weight and increases stability. Precise steering and maximum tyre grip on all road surfaces make driving manoeuvres a pleasure for all passengers.

Delivering unrivalled driving dynamics with unparalleled comfort, the patented integral V rear axle has been specially developed for the BMW 7 Series. Dynamic and drive forces acting on the wheel suspension are taken up by the wheel mounts, the rear axle subframe, the swinging arm and three track control arms. The BMW 7 Series long version also boasts self-levelling air suspension at the rear to ensure that the vehicle offers a consistent ride height and maximum comfort.

Tehnical characteristics - BMW 7 Series

Engine
Cylinders / valves/cyl.
8/4
Capacity in cm³
4.395
Stroke/Bore in mm
88,3/89,0
Maximum power (kW (HP) at rpm)
342 (465)/5.500 - 6.000
Maximum torque (Nm at rpm)
700/2.000 - 3.000
Road performance
Drag coefficient (cw)
0,31
Maximum speed in km/h, xDrive
250
Acceleration 0 – 100 km/h (s), xDrive
4,9
Consumption
Urban cycle (l/100 km), xDrive
12,6
Extra-urban cycle (l/100 km), xDrive
7,6
Combined cycle (l/100 km), xDrive
9,4
CO2 emissions (g/km), xDrive
219
Tank capacity (l)
80
Weight in kg
Kerb weight, xDrive
2.120
Maximum permissible weight, xDrive
2.635
Payload
590
Permitted axle load front/rear
1.310/1.440
Rims
Front tire dimensions
245/45 R 19 Y
Rear tire dimensions
275/40 R 19 Y
Front wheel dimensions
8 J x 19 light alloy
Rear wheel dimensions
8,5 J x 19 light alloy
